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8757765 2685017 789
76557223181 851177922
76557223181 851177922
997 78 690
All about undefined
Interested in learning more?
76557223181 851177922
997 78 690
See more
4218 11
98209856536 130306 28 5307045 16766
See more
18437440 602655294
76 604648992 922604 632867 727570819
See more